Verdict
BORDER REIVER won off a 5lb higher mark over C&D in May last year and the ground has turned in his favour again. Tim Easterby's eight-year-old is taken to end his long losing run though Kosta Brava is capable of putting up a bold show under top weight and Qoubilai was only beaten a head by North Stack on his debut for Tim Vaughan at Market Rasen. Kilkenny All Star won off this mark in the autumn but has been below his best lately and may find this company too hot.
